MEMO — Kettling Depot Receiving

Uniform sets for the new Kettling depot arrive Wednesday via Ashgrove courier: 40 boxes, sorted by size, manifest attached to box one. Check the count at the dock before signing; shortages go straight to stores, not the courier. The hand-over instruction the courier will follow is set out below.

drop instructions, tafof-baguf: the holmir gilox courier leaves the sormir ulaok holdor ledger at gate 5596 under passcode 257343

## Support

The Veridex plugin system loads validator modules from the `validators/` registry at startup. When reviewing a new plugin, confirm it declares a schema version, passes the conformance suite, and avoids blocking I/O in the `check()` hook. Breaking changes to the plugin ABI require a design note and sign-off from the core maintainers. Reviews should normally complete within two business days. If a review stalls or you hit an ambiguous ABI question, contact the maintainer rotation directly.

escalation mailbox, bafog-fafog: ulador@paliqlabs.internal

## Who to ping about GiftNote

Welcome aboard! GiftNote is our donation-receipt mailer for the Larchfield Fund. Template tweaks go to the comms folks; delivery failures and bounce weirdness go to the platform crew. Don't push template changes on Fridays — receipts batch over the weekend. For anything GiftNote-related, start with the address below.

billing contact of kaweg-tajeg = drudor.lamion.oliath@torvalabs.test